- Preparing search index...
- The search index is not available
autouml
Constructors
constructor
- new Visitor(map?, relations?): Visitor
-
Methods
Private
_visit
- _visit(scope): string[]
-
Returns string[]
Protected
Abstract
compileRelations
- compileRelations(): string
-
Returns string
visit
- visit(map?, relations?): string
-
Returns string
Protected
Abstract
visitClass
- visitClass(scope, childData, fieldData, methodData): string[]
-
Parameters
-
-
childData: string[][]
-
fieldData: string[][]
-
methodData: string[][]
Returns string[]
Protected
Abstract
visitClassField
- visitClassField(f): string[]
-
Returns string[]
Protected
Abstract
visitClassMethod
- visitClassMethod(m): string[]
-
Returns string[]
Protected
Abstract
visitEnum
- visitEnum(scope, childData, enumData): string[]
-
Parameters
-
-
childData: string[][]
-
enumData: string[][]
Returns string[]
Protected
Abstract
visitEnumField
- visitEnumField(f): string[]
-
Returns string[]
Protected
Abstract
visitFile
- visitFile(scope, childData): string[]
-
Returns string[]
Protected
Abstract
visitInterface
- visitInterface(scope, childData, interfaceData): string[]
-
Parameters
-
-
childData: string[][]
-
interfaceData: string[][]
Returns string[]
Protected
Abstract
visitInterfaceField
- visitInterfaceField(f): string[]
-
Returns string[]
Protected
Abstract
visitNamespace
- visitNamespace(scope, childData): string[]
-
Returns string[]
Protected
Abstract
visitProgram
- visitProgram(scope, childData): string[]
-
Returns string[]